在VB.NET的ASP页面中,可以使用以下代码示例解决授权问题:
1.使用Windows用户的身份授权:
Dim user As String = HttpContext.Current.User.Identity.Name
2.检查用户是否有特定的权限:
If HttpContext.Current.User.IsInRole("Administrators") Then '具有管理员权限 ElseIf HttpContext.Current.User.IsInRole("Users") Then '具有用户权限 Else '未经授权访问 Response.Redirect("~/Login.aspx") End If
3.在web.config文件中配置授权:
上述代码示例可以在VB.NET的ASP页面中解决授权问题。通过使用Windows用户的身份授权、检查用户是否有特定的权限和配置web.config文件来确保在Web应用程序中实现安全的授权控制。